How they compare

Lower middle income currently reports 48.89 billion current US$ against 30.09 billion current US$ in Austria, a difference of 18.80 billion current US$.

That makes Lower middle income's figure about 1.6 times Austria's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 10 shared years of data; in 2014 it was Austria ahead.

Austria ranks 24th and Lower middle income ranks 22nd of 176 countries.

Lower middle income has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

High-technology exports are products with high R&D intensity, such as aerospace, computers, pharmaceuticals, scientific instruments, and electrical machinery.
